Gay Travel – Rue de L’Espoir – Providence, RI

Rue De L’ Espoir / 99 Hope Street / Providence, RI 02906 / 401-751-8890 Rue De L’Espoir is a Rhode Island institution. The Rue, as it is affectionately referred to, opened in  May 1976. Over the past 36 years, The Rue has experienced continued success and has been featured in travel books and magazines, including Esquire, Bon Appetit, Food … Continue reading
